Why confidence scores instead of a "verified" badge?+

Because "verified" gets misused across this industry. A pattern we've seen hundreds of times for a domain deserves more trust than one we've only seen once or twice. We show you the real number behind every guess — and when the data genuinely doesn't support a confident answer, we say "insufficient data" instead of making one up.

How big is the database behind the score?+

About 2.2M distinct email patterns across roughly 1.68M verified company domains, continuously growing.
